Luxurious Resort, with a Portugese Colonial-inspired facade, on 55 acres of tropical plants & palms overlooking the Arabian Sea.
viewing Taj Exotica Resort & Spa as an exceptional platform to seamlessly integrate India's time-honored traditions with the ...